跳到內容

unicorn/prefer-reflect-apply 樣式

這個規則的作用

為什麼這樣不好?

Reflect.apply() 可以說是更簡潔且更容易理解。此外,當您接受任意方法時,假設 .apply() 存在或未被覆寫是不安全的。

範例

此規則的不正確程式碼範例

javascript
foo.apply(null, [42]);

此規則的正確程式碼範例

javascript
Reflect.apply(foo, null);

參考資料

以 MIT 許可證發布。